What does Citrus Limon Fruit Extract do in a cosmetic formula?
This ingredient is primarily a botanical skin-conditioning extract, used for mild astringent, antioxidant, and radiance-positioned support. It is not typically the main preservative, exfoliant, or fragrance system, even though it can contribute acidity and a faint natural scent.
Is Citrus Limon Fruit Extract clean?
Clean-beauty frameworks generally accept it, but it carries caveats for sensitive skin because organic acids and trace fragrance components can be irritating at higher levels. It is usually not a restricted-list issue, though allergen disclosure may matter when fragrance allergens are present above labeling thresholds.
Is Citrus Limon Fruit Extract sustainable?
This ingredient is plant-derived and expected to be readily biodegradable, with a sourcing footprint tied to edible-crop agriculture, water use, and extraction method. Use of processing byproducts and low-impact solvents improves its sustainability profile.
Is Citrus Limon Fruit Extract COSMOS-approved?
It is generally permitted under COSMOS natural and organic standards when made from approved plant raw material using allowed extraction solvents, with organic status dependent on certified feedstock. It fits Green Chemistry best when produced through water, glycerin, or ethanol extraction and preserved with standard-approved systems.
How does Citrus Limon Fruit Extract work chemically?
This material is a complex aqueous, glycolic, or hydroalcoholic extract containing organic acids, sugars, flavonoids, phenolic compounds, and trace volatile fragrance molecules. Typical use is often around 0.1% to 5%, and formulators watch pH, preservation, color shift, odor drift, and light or heat exposure in water-based products.
